Timmy, the stuffed tiger, wakes up alone in a junk yard. Through the help of his family and new found friends, he sets out on a journey to return home. With danger lurking around every corner, the group must rely upon the assistance of others to survive. Will Timmy have the courage necessary to get them all safely home or will they all perish?
